Transaction e4b8656101d82d333d77e8e97e56a8759a713f45e74190ea6ad1a68807fe0d83
1 Input
1 Output
-
e4b8656101d82d333d77e8e97e56a8759a713f45e74190ea6ad1a68807fe0d83:0
- value
- 5650600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f93824aed4db91ede107cfec22a5fc8cb830fd4d OP_EQUAL
- address
- 3QQmSDMntFDT7tFA4YfY2YgTZ7sH9VnFsr